Government assures flood hit regions more financial support to come
The government is assuring flood hit regions there's more financial support to come after announcing an immediate $2.2 million relief package. $1.2 million of that will go into topping up mayoral relief funds, while the other $1 million will reimburse marae that have provided welfare support to communities. Tairawhiti's East Cape has been hit hard, communities remain isolated, some homes are uninhabitable and lifeline roads are still touch and go. The mayor says it will take a lot to get the area back on its feet. Mayor for the District, Rehette Stoltz spoke to Lisa Owen.
